3 month of nightmares, not sure about the color code, thinking maybe the car will be orange or burgundy or maybe PINK

But no

A real, nice, dark candy apple red. cannot wait to see the exterior

And yes its a bit expensive. 2k$ + only in paint material, about a 8-10K$ paint but its a dream color... really worth it for me

If you think about a candy for your car (red, blue, orange..) whitout a doubt the HOK kandy paint is a good choice
